Overview Tamque 0.4mg Tablet

Alfaprost 0.4mg tablets, an alpha-blocker, treat ben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H), easing urination difficulties. This medication doesn't shrink the prostate. Always follow your doctor's prescribed dosage and schedule; it can be taken with or without food, but consistently at the same time each day. Swallow the tablet whole. Discontinue use only under medical supervision, as abrupt cessation may worsen symptoms. Complete the prescribed course for optimal results. Common side effects include dizziness, backache, chest discomfort, ejaculatory dysfunction, and retrograde ejaculation. Report persistent or bothersome side effects immediately to your physician. Lifestyle modifications can improve symptom management. Void as soon as you feel the urge, but avoid straining. Limit or avoid caffeinated and alcoholic beverages before bedtime and several hours prior to outings. Before starting treatment, disclose all other medications and health conditions to your doctor. Inform your ophthalmologist about Alfaprost use before any cataract or glaucoma surgery. Patients with liver impairment require close medical monitoring.

How Tamque 0.4mg Tablet works:

Tamque 0.4mg tablets function as an alpha-adrenergic antagonist. By relaxing the muscles in the bladder neck and prostate, they facilitate smoother urine flow. This promotes complete bladder emptying and lessens the frequency and urgency of urination associated with ben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H).

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Concurrent use of Tamque 0.4mg tablets and alcohol may lead to increased sleepiness.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data on the use of Tamque 0.4mg Tablet in pregnancy is absent. Seek medical advice from your physician.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Tamque 0.4mg Tablet while breastfeeding is likely unsafe. Available human data indicates potential transfer to breast milk, posing a risk to the infant. This medication is contraindicated in lactating women.

DrivingDrivingSAFE

Driving ability is typically unaffected by Tamque 0.4mg tablets.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Tamque 0.4mg tablets are considered safe for patients with kidney impairment; dosage modification is not typically necessary. Nevertheless, data on Tamque 0.4mg tablet use in patients experiencing end-stage renal disease is scarce. Physician consultation is advised.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Individuals with severe h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Tamque 0.4mg t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Tamque 0.4mg Tablet :

Should you forget a Tamque 0.4mg Tablet dose, administer it at your earliest convenience.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Tamque 0.4mg Tablet

Take the capsule about 30 minutes after your first meal of the day, consistently—either breakfast or dinner, as some doctors recommend nighttime use. Swallow it whole with water; do not crush or chew.
Tamque 0.4mg tablets do not raise blood sugar. Report any blood sugar level changes to your doctor, as this may indicate another medical condition.
Tamque 0.4mg tablets typically do not cause weight gain, even with prolonged use. However, if you gain weight while taking this medication, consult your doctor.
You may notice improved urine flow within 4 to 8 hours of taking a 0.4mg Tamque tablet, though complete effectiveness may take 2 to 4 weeks.
Yes, it's safe to take Tamque 0.4mg tablets with vitamin D; no adverse interactions are known.
Tamque 0.4mg tablets facilitate kidney stone passage through urine by relaxing urinary tract muscles. This eases stone removal and reduces the need for pain medication.
Tamque 0.4mg Tablets dilate blood vessels, causing blood to pool in the extremities. This reduced blood flow to the brain can lead to a sudden drop in blood pressure upon postural change, resulting in dizziness, lightheadedness, fainting, vertigo, or a spinning sensation.
Tamque 0.4mg tablets may induce floppy iris syndrome, causing unexpected pupil constriction during cataract surgery. This can hinder the surgeon's view, limiting the surgical field and potentially impacting outcomes.
Tamque 0.4mg tablets relax blood vessel muscles, leading to vasodilation and potentially a stuffy nose.
Tamque 0.4mg tablets don't contain anticholinergic agents. Instead, they relax prostate and bladder neck muscles, easing urine flow in men with benign prostatic hyperplasia. Combining Tamque 0.4mg with anticholinergics may exacerbate symptoms.
Tamque 0.4mg tablets do not cause frequent urination; instead, they reduce it. This medication improves urine flow and lessens the urge to urinate often, a common symptom of ben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H). BPH also causes weak urinary streams and incomplete bladder emptying. Tamque 0.4mg tablets treat these urinary symptoms associated with BPH.
While Tamque 0.4mg Tablets typically don't produce side effects in patients with benign prostatic hyperplasia, prolonged use might increase the risk of infections (including rhinitis and pharyngitis), pain, ejaculatory dysfunction, and vasovagal symptoms such as fainting, lightheadedness, dizziness, and hypotension.
Managing your symptoms is easier with simple lifestyle adjustments. Void your bladder promptly when you feel the urge, but avoid straining. Limit fluids, particularly alcohol and caffeine, in the hours before sleep or outings. Always consult your doctor before taking any additional medication, as some can worsen urinary urgency.
Ibuprofen or paracetamol may be taken concurrently with Tamque 0.4mg Tablet without known adverse interactions.
